KESPEN Window Privacy Film One Way Daytime Privacy

The KESPEN film is designed for daytime privacy with a purple-silver reflective effect. It blocks 78% of infrared rays and 97% of UV rays, helping protect interiors from fading and reducing glare. With a 7% VLT, it allows some visible light in while maintaining privacy from the outside during daylight. It also reflects heat to help with energy savings in homes and offices. Best for buyers seeking a non-permanent privacy solution that preserves some outside view and can be used on larger panes. A limitation is that at night, when interior lights are on, the mirror effect fades, reducing privacy; curtains are needed then. Suitable for: home offices, living rooms, and entrances where daytime privacy is the priority.
Why this pick? It combines significant UV protection with heat control and a visible-light transmission that keeps interiors bright enough during the day while maintaining external privacy. The purple-silver finish adds a decorative accent without sacrificing function.

Buying Guide: Key Considerations For Reflective Purple Window Tint
- Placement: Home or car? Vehicle films emphasize heat rejection and UV protection, while home films focus on privacy and interior glare reduction. Choose based on where you want the tint to perform best.
- Light Transmission: VLT (visible light transmission) values determine brightness and privacy. Lower VLT means darker tint; higher VLT means more light inside. Balance privacy with interior visibility.
- Privacy Type: One-way mirror films offer daytime privacy but can lose the mirror effect at night. If night privacy is essential, consider complementary window coverings.
- UV And Heat Control: All options claim UV protection and heat reduction to varying degrees. If furniture fading is a concern, prioritize higher UV rejection and heat blocking.
- Color And Aesthetics: Purple tones range from subtle purple-silver to vivid chameleon effects. For vehicles, ensure color matches your style and complies with local regulations.
- Easy Installation: DIY-friendly films often require cleaning, cutting, and careful application to avoid air bubbles. Some films are more forgiving on flat surfaces than curved glass.
- Durability And Maintenance: Look for dirt- and grime-resistant surfaces. Some vinyl sheets are easier to remove or replace than permanent films.
- Legal Considerations: Vehicle tint laws vary by state. Check local regulations on VLT, front windshield tint, and allowed reflectivity before installation.
